Composite Materials: Fabrication Handbook #2 (Composite Garage Series), by John Wanberg

Written for those who want to enhance the quality and performance of their composite projects, Composites Fabrication Handbook #2 focuses on what it takes to truly optimize a composite lamination for high-performance use. Basic mold-making is covered in this book to help fabricators produce effective mold systems from a variety of molding materials. Several advanced molding techniques are demonstrated in-depth so the reader will be able to create their own parts using compression molding, vacuum-bagging, trapped-rubber insert molding, inflatable bladder molding, or resin transfer molding techniques. In the spirit of Composites Fabrication Handbook #1, this book presents each subject in a hands-on, practical way and facilitates a natural progression of skills to enable both beginners and advanced fabricators alike to build their composite projects with confidence.

Creating useful composite parts requires a good design, a topic that is discussed at length in this book. The methods illustrated here lend themselves to both motorcycle and automotive builders and customizers. The construction of these parts is documented in step-by-step fashion with an abundance of photographs - no step is left out.

The ideal author for a composite materials book, John Wanberg - is an Assistant Professor of Industrial Design at Metropolitan State College of Denver where he teaches design materials and studio classes. He has worked professionally in the design and manufacture of varied composite products ranging from wearable medical robotic devices to aftermarket automotive parts and alternatively powered vehicles.

Good Coverage of Non-structural Composites
By P Lam
Books 1 and 2 provide good photo-coverage of composite introduction and fabrication. Step-by-step details are clearly depicted from the making of simple parts to production tooling. All are done in non-technical, easy-to-understand fashion.

Be aware though, as stated on the covers, these books are in the "garage series" and are geared towards hands-on fabrication (as opposed to design). The emphasis is towards cosmetic rather than high-efficiency structural applications.

So if your interests are towards building hood scoops, cycle fenders, etc, you will find these books highly informative.

If your interest are towards aerospace or racecar structural composites where high-strength and light-weight are paramount, look elsewhere. Also, if you are looking for information on technical design of composites, look elsewhere.

Composite Materials: Fabrication Handbook #2 - must buy for DIY enthusiasts
By David Cockburn
I bought this item with Composite Materials: Fabrication Handbook #1. Both are well written in a logical fashion and there are a lot of full-coloured pictures which really help with the understanding of the topic. The book is written so that someone with no knowledge of composite materials can easily understand and get into their first project with some level of confidence.

My only complaint is that the text and corresponding pictures are at times not placed near to each other, so there is a good bit of page turning when one wants to get a visual to the text being read. Other than that, this book is a must have for the DIY enthusiast who would like to start working with composite materials.
